It's an excellent idea for that TG squad of 6 to split into 2 or 3 Learn TG squads. Once you have 2 people following orders and interacting with the SL, usually everyone else in the squad will follow. If not, I suppose you can give them a warning and then kick them out of your squad to make room for someone else who wants to be a part of the team.

When I do SL, I'll be sure to call it LearnTG and I'll try not to be so taciturn

TG_Bear,
That's unforunately one of the downfalls of manual admin kicking to make room for squad members. It's impossible for admins to know everyone who is a SM and so once in awhile they will kick someone they should not.

Oiy, I feel so lost as a squad leader sometimes. I still don't know the "TG Way" too well yet, although I did pick up some from the Learn TG squads I've been in.
The easiest way to do that is issuing orders. I was in a squad tonight where the SL didn't assign orders at all. While he was somewhat talkative, it was very confusing without any issued orders. With orders, other TG squad members can at least check for a reminder where to be and organize themselves.
